Director of Testing Center, Accommodative Services, and First Year Programs

James A. Rhodes State College
01.2019 - Current
  • Oversee placement testing and the computerized placement test management system
  • Manage the administration of disability accommodation testing, academic makeup exams, etc;
  • Administer national testing programs
  • Supervise the administration of exams given on behalf of other post-secondary institutions and organizations
  • Coordinate off-site testing as needed in support of educational and professional partnerships
  • Ensure compliance with professional certification exams and protocols
  • Monitor and assess all activities and program of the Testing Center for efficiency and effectiveness
  • Oversee the day-to-day processing procedures of candidates, scheduling, downloading of tests, etc
  • Prepare and disseminate monthly, quarterly and yearly activity/outcome reports
  • Maintain inventory of testing materials, supplies, and other resources
  • Arrange for hardware and software upgrades and installation of testing software
  • Oversee staff hiring, training, scheduling, and evaluations for the Testing Center
  • Ensure all staff maintain current appropriate certification and qualifications as required
  • Ensure compliance with federal and state laws; Maintain currency with federal and state standards for accommodations
  • Research and assign accommodations as appropriate to students' documentation and needs
  • Create and maintain a database of accommodative requests
  • Prepare and submit reports to appropriate state federal and state agencies
  • Assist in faculty development to ensure accommodative plans are implemented
  • Designed, developed, and implemented a sensory room
  • Created a therapy dog program “Pause for Paws”
  • Former Grant manager for Choose Ohio First Scholarship
  • Grant manager for Ohio REACH
  • Oversee online and in-person Orientation
  • Support first year students as they enter college
  • Rhodes State College is a public, state-assisted institution of higher learning which is chartered to provide degree granting career education programs, non-credit workforce development, and consulting for business and industry.
